"""Generate tests for extensions that affect the shading language. This generates three tests per extensions. - The first test asserts that if the extension is required it's defined - The second test asserts that if the extension isn't available it's not defined - The third test asserts that if the extension isn't available trying to require it is an error. These are glslparsertests. If the requirement for the test is less than OpenGL Shader Language 140, then two tests will be made, a core and a compat. If it's greater then only a core will be made, these will have compat and core added to the name, respectively. For OpenGL ES only one test will be generated, it will have es added to the name of the test.
